Itching in eye
I am facing some issue in my eye.when I rub my eye it feels good, but my eye goes red . It can happen any time

Hello. I think you have allergic conjunctivitis. 1. Eye allergies, called allergic conjunctivitis, are a common condition that occurs when the eyes react to something that irritates them (called an allergen). 2. The eyes produce a substance called histamine to fight off the allergen. As a result, the eyelids and conjunctiva (the thin, filmy membrane that covers the inside of your eyelids) become red, swollen and itchy, with tearing and burning. The key to treating eye allergies is a. Avoid or limit contact with the substance causing the problem. B. Avoid rubbing eyes instead do cold compresses. C. Use antiallergic eyedrop like olopat eyedrop twice daily d. Lubricating eyedrop like flogel thrice daily e. Use mild steroid like flurisone in pulse dose in severe allergy this will help you I am very sorry dear to say that there is no medicine that can cure allergy. Only way is to stay away from all those things that you are allergic to. This is a provisional diagnosis. consult your ophthalmologist for detailed examination

Hello there.... Following these steps will help.... Use a wet washcloth to clean off the eyelids and face...Rinse the eyes with a small amount of warm water. Tears will do the rest....Then put a cold wet washcloth on the itchy eye.....Wash the hair every night because it collects lots of pollen..... Consult your ophthalmologist if symptoms persists....
